Output caab14568a1ef3260470067bde4c6323a5823c664e9fee5419609d6f3b95ea7f:65

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08210521d72db32c5bb23e491a7646f328d76de8b72f93cd94ad9f428af2ea70
address
bc1ppqss2gwh9kejckaj8ey35ajx7v5dwm0gkuhe8nv54k059zhjafcqm4h5ry
transaction
caab14568a1ef3260470067bde4c6323a5823c664e9fee5419609d6f3b95ea7f
spent
true